Safe Hideout or Illusory Assurance? WWII Fortifications Examined
Constructed in World War II, these massive underground complexes offered what seemed like absolute safety from aerial bombardment . Originally intended as safe havens for civilians and armed forces personnel, many WWII bunkers now stand as silent reminders of a time of profound conflict. Yet, a closer look reveals that this perception of security was not always reliable . While granting some measure of shielding , bunkers were vulnerable to damage from concentrated hits, infiltration , and even lack of ventilation, raising questions about whether they truly represented a assurance of survival or merely a misleading sense of security .

Debunking the Underground Fantasy: WWII & Modern Survival
The romantic notion of a secure underground shelter, popularized by the Second World War narratives and now fanned by modern survivalist culture, often overlooks a critical assessment. While earlier bunkers offered some measure of defense against aerial attacks, they were typically cramped, unsanitary, and reliant on complex resource chains that were prone to disruption. Today's survival scenarios, spanning from economic collapse to environmental disasters, present problems that traditional bunker layouts are ill-equipped to handling. Maintaining long-term habitability – necessitating reliable food farming, water treatment, and garbage management – is far more complicated than many suppose, ultimately highlighting the underground dream to be more illusion than practical solution for real survival.
